Transaction 4758405af537601ea3748bb5f6f1c9b1166b1a7040ffefc3eedd8caa3f5a23f3

4 Input
1 Outputs
  • 4758405af537601ea3748bb5f6f1c9b1166b1a7040ffefc3eedd8caa3f5a23f3:0
  • value  6370328
    address  3JrnZDb2SUoKHfmUkKJ2MtxUfkgVYVk6jR